Benefits of Online Education

Online education offers a range of benefits that make it an attractive option for many learners.

  • Flexibility and Convenience:Online programs allow students to learn at their own pace and on their own schedule, making it easier to balance education with work, family, and other commitments. This flexibility is particularly appealing to working professionals, parents, and individuals with busy lifestyles.

  • Accessibility:Online education removes geographical barriers, allowing students to access courses and programs from anywhere in the world. This is particularly beneficial for individuals living in remote areas or those who cannot relocate for educational purposes.
  • Affordability:Online programs can often be more affordable than traditional programs, as they eliminate the need for expensive commuting, housing, and other associated costs. This makes higher education more accessible to a wider range of individuals.
  • Personalized Learning:Online platforms can provide personalized learning experiences, tailoring content and instruction to individual student needs and learning styles. This can lead to improved engagement and better learning outcomes.
  • Greater Choice:Online education offers a wider range of courses and programs than traditional institutions, allowing students to pursue their specific interests and career goals.

Challenges of Online Education

While online education offers many advantages, it also presents some challenges.

  • Motivation and Self-Discipline:Online learning requires a high level of self-motivation and discipline, as students are responsible for managing their own learning and staying on track. This can be challenging for some individuals who may struggle with procrastination or lack of structure.

  • Technical Issues:Technical difficulties, such as internet connectivity problems or software issues, can disrupt the learning process. This can be frustrating for students and may require them to adapt their learning habits or seek technical support.
  • Lack of Social Interaction:Online learning can sometimes lack the social interaction and community that is present in traditional classrooms. This can be a drawback for students who thrive in collaborative learning environments or who value the social aspect of education.
  • Limited Hands-on Experience:Some online programs may not provide the same hands-on experience as traditional programs, particularly in fields that require practical skills. This is a consideration for students who need hands-on training or who prefer a more experiential learning approach.
  • Quality Variation:The quality of online education programs can vary widely, so it is important for students to carefully research and select programs from reputable institutions.

Types of Online Education Programs

Online education programs are available at various levels, including:

  • Certificate Programs:These programs provide specialized training in a specific field or area of expertise. They are typically shorter than degree programs and can be a good option for individuals seeking to enhance their skills or change careers.
  • Associate Degrees:These two-year programs provide a foundation in a particular field and prepare students for entry-level positions or further education. They are offered in a wide range of subjects, including business, healthcare, and technology.
  • Bachelor’s Degrees:These four-year programs provide a comprehensive education in a specific field and prepare students for professional careers. They are offered in a wide range of subjects, including arts, sciences, business, and engineering.
  • Master’s Degrees:These advanced programs provide specialized knowledge and skills in a particular field and prepare students for leadership roles or research positions. They are offered in a wide range of subjects, including business, education, and healthcare.
  • Doctoral Degrees:These advanced programs are designed for students who want to pursue research careers or teach at the university level. They require significant time and dedication and typically involve original research and dissertation writing.

Education Technology in Online Learning

Education technology plays a crucial role in facilitating online learning.

  • Learning Management Systems (LMS):LMS platforms provide a centralized hub for online courses, offering features such as course materials, assignments, quizzes, discussion forums, and grade tracking. Examples of popular LMS platforms include Moodle, Canvas, and Blackboard.
  • Video Conferencing:Video conferencing tools allow students and instructors to interact in real-time, enabling live lectures, group discussions, and virtual office hours. Popular video conferencing platforms include Zoom, Google Meet, and Microsoft Teams.
  • Interactive Learning Tools:Interactive learning tools, such as simulations, games, and virtual labs, provide engaging and immersive learning experiences. These tools can help students visualize concepts, practice skills, and develop critical thinking abilities.
  • Mobile Learning:Mobile devices, such as smartphones and tablets, have become essential tools for online learning, providing students with access to course materials, online discussions, and assessments on the go.
  • Adaptive Learning:Adaptive learning platforms use artificial intelligence to personalize the learning experience for each student, adjusting the pace and difficulty of instruction based on individual progress and needs.

Successful Online Education Programs

There are numerous examples of successful online education programs that have had a positive impact on students.

  • Khan Academy:Khan Academy is a non-profit organization that provides free online courses and resources in a wide range of subjects, from mathematics and science to history and art. It has been credited with providing access to high-quality education to millions of students worldwide.

  • Coursera:Coursera is an online learning platform that offers courses and programs from top universities and institutions around the world. It has become a popular destination for individuals seeking to acquire new skills, advance their careers, or explore new interests.
  • edX:edX is another online learning platform that offers courses and programs from leading universities and institutions. It is known for its focus on high-quality education and its commitment to open access.

FAQs

What are the different types of financial aid available for online education?

Financial aid for online education includes federal grants and loans, state grants, institutional scholarships, employer tuition reimbursement programs, and private loans.

Can I use my GI Bill benefits for online education?

Yes, many online education programs are eligible for GI Bill benefits. Contact the school’s financial aid office to determine if your program qualifies.

Is it easier to get financial aid for online education than for traditional programs?

The eligibility criteria for financial aid are generally the same for both online and traditional programs. However, some scholarships or grants may be specifically designed for online learners.

What is the FAFSA and how do I complete it?

The Free Application for Federal Student Aid (FAFSA) is a form used to determine your eligibility for federal student aid. You can complete the FAFSA online at fafsa.gov.
